- The distance between Kotzebue/ Ralph Wien, Ak, Usa and Elkins/ Randolph Co, Wv, Usa is approximately 5,781 km or 3,592 mi.
- To reach Kotzebue/ Ralph Wien, Ak in this distance one would set out from Elkins/ Randolph Co, Wv bearing 330.4°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kotzebue/ Ralph Wien, Ak bearing 258.6° or WSW .
- Kotzebue/ Ralph Wien, Ak has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Elkins/ Randolph Co, Wv has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The mean annual temperature is 15.3 °C (27.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.4 °C (16.9°F) more in Kotzebue/ Ralph Wien, Ak.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 910.9 mm (35.9 in) less which is equivalent to 910.9 l/m² (22.36 US gal/ft²) or 9,109,000 l/ha (973,813 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.9° lower in Kotzebue/ Ralph Wien, Ak than in Elkins/ Randolph Co, Wv.
